From 35439b7ab2dbd458377efaa979820360f4951784 Mon Sep 17 00:00:00 2001 From: Tony Lindgren Date: Sun, 7 Apr 2019 11:12:51 -0700 Subject: [PATCH] power: supply: cpcap-battery: Fix coulomb counter calibration register use The coulomb counter calibration is not CCO, it's CCM. And the CCM is nine bits wide signed register, so let's use sign_extend32() for it.
